Comparative evaluation of ChatGPT, Gemini, and Grok in clinical decision-making and general knowledge assessment for
Genta Agani Sabah1, Mehmet Gümüş Kanmaz2
1Department of Orthodontics, Izmir Tinaztepe University, Izmir, Türkiye.
Objective:
This study aimed to compare extraction versus orthodontic eruption decisions for impacted maxillary canines made by three artificial intelligence-based chatbots (ChatGPT, Gemini, and Grok) with those made by orthodontist raters, and to evaluate the overall accuracy of these artificial intelligence-generated recommendations.
Methods:
Thirty-three patients with impacted maxillary canines were selected, and standardized case scenarios incorporating key diagnostic parameters were presented to the three chatbots. Their treatment decisions were recorded and compared with orthodontists' consensus decisions. Additionally, 10 general queries regarding impacted maxillary canines were submitted to the chatbots. The responses were rated by three orthodontists using a modified 5-point Global Quality Score.
Results:
The chatbots and orthodontists showed moderate agreement regarding treatment decisions (κ = 0.411-0.524, P < 0.05). Gemini produced significantly more discordant responses, frequently over-recommending orthodontic eruptions (P = 0.002), whereas Grok and ChatGPT received significantly higher scores than Gemini in the case-based scenarios (P < 0.001). Grok outperformed both ChatGPT and Gemini for general queries (P = 0.006).
Conclusions:
While Gemini showed lower clinical alignment with orthodontists for treatment decisions regarding impacted canines, ChatGPT and Grok demonstrated moderate agreement with orthodontists and produced relatively accurate responses. These findings highlight the potential of chatbots as supportive tools for orthodontic decision-making. However, their use requires careful supervision to avoid the risks associated with inaccurate or misleading recommendations.
